Serotonin-13C, D4
Serotonin-13C, D4 (5-Hydroxytryptamine-13C, D4) is a 13C- and deuterated labeled Serotonin (HY-B1473A) . Serotonin is a monoamine neurotransmitter in the CNS and an endogenous 5-HT receptor agonist. Serotonin is also a catechol O-methyltransferase (COMT) inhibitor with a Ki of 44 μM[1][2].
